I'm doing a little research on the intermediate steering shaft for a 2004 CE Z06. For those of you that have a CE is there a label warning about removal of the shaft glued to it? The label looks like the one in the attachment.....
It’s simply warning not to turn the steering wheel if not hooked up to the steering gear via the shaft with the sticker.
The steering wheel has a small clock spring that will break if turned too many times (which isn’t possible if the shaft was hooked up).
